The Complexities of Buying a Franchise

Purchasing a franchise is not as simple as picking a brand and signing a contract. A franchise consultant helps prospective franchisees navigate the complexities involved in the process, including:

  • Understanding different franchise concepts and how they align with your goals.
  • Evaluating the financial investment and expected return.
  • Reviewing legal documents, such as the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D).
  • Negotiating terms and ensuring compliance with franchise regulations.

Without proper guidance, individuals may choose the wrong franchise, overestimate profitability, or enter agreements with unfavorable terms. A consultant provides clarity and ensures you make an informed decision.

Why Franchising Your Business Requires Expert Support

If you’re a business owner considering franchising your business, a franchise consultant can help streamline the process and set you up for long-term success. Here’s how:

Developing a Scalable Model

Ensuring your business is franchise-ready requires adjusting operations, branding, and legal structures. A consultant helps you create a system that allows franchisees to replicate your business model efficiently.

Creating Franchise Documents

From franchise agreements to operational manuals, consultants help draft essential documentation. These documents outline everything from training processes to brand guidelines, ensuring consistency across all franchise locations.

Compliance and Regulations

Franchise laws vary by state and country. A consultant ensures all regulatory requirements are met, helping you avoid costly legal complications that could delay your expansion.

Attracting Franchisees

A consultant helps market your franchise opportunity to the right investors. They assist in identifying ideal franchisees who align with your brand values and have the necessary resources to succeed.

Expanding a business through franchising is a major step. Having an expert on your side ensures the process is efficient and profitable.

Common Pitfalls of Going Solo

1. Choosing the Wrong Franchise

Without proper research, you might invest in a franchise that doesn’t align with your skills or goals. Some franchises have hidden challenges, and without expert insight, you might overlook red flags.

2. Underestimating Costs

Many new franchisees fail to account for marketing, staffing, and operational expenses. A consultant helps create an accurate financial projection, ensuring you’re fully prepared.

3. Ignoring Legalities

Overlooking franchise regulations can lead to legal disputes and financial losses. A consultant ensures that all agreements and documents comply with state and federal laws, protecting you from legal issues.

4. Lack of Support

Without expert guidance, troubleshooting challenges becomes more difficult. Franchisees often struggle with operational hurdles, marketing strategies, and hiring staff. A consultant helps you address these challenges proactively.

5. Limited Negotiation Power

Franchise agreements can be complex, and terms may not always favor the franchisee. Consultants use their experience to negotiate better terms and conditions, ensuring a fair deal.

How to Choose the Right Franchise Consultant

If you’ve decided to work with a franchise consultant, finding the right expert is crucial. Here are key factors to consider:

1. Experience and Track Record

Look for consultants with a proven history of helping clients find successful franchises. Ask about their experience and success stories.

2. Industry Connections

A good consultant has access to a wide network of franchise concepts and industry professionals, giving you access to exclusive opportunities.

3. Transparent Fees

Some consultants charge upfront fees, while others work on commission. Understand their pricing structure and ensure it aligns with your budget.

4. Client Testimonials

Read reviews and testimonials from past clients to gauge their reputation and effectiveness.
